Posted: Sun Jan 04, 2004 4:54 am Post subject: emerge Digest-HMAC fails. Log inside. |
|
|
| Code: | >>> Source unpacked.
Checking if your kit is complete...
Looks good
Writing Makefile for Digest::HMAC
cp lib/Digest/HMAC_MD5.pm blib/lib/Digest/HMAC_MD5.pm
cp lib/Digest/HMAC.pm blib/lib/Digest/HMAC.pm
cp lib/Digest/HMAC_SHA1.pm blib/lib/Digest/HMAC_SHA1.pm
Manifying blib/man3/Digest::HMAC_MD5.3pm
Manifying blib/man3/Digest::HMAC.3pm
Manifying blib/man3/Digest::HMAC_SHA1.3pm
PERL_DL_NONLAZY=1 /usr/bin/perl "-MExtUtils::Command::MM" "-e" "test_harness(0, 'blib/lib', 'blib/arch')" t/*.t
t/rfc2202....Can't locate auto/Digest/SHA1/reset.al in @INC (@INC contains: /var/tmp/portage/Digest-HMAC-1.01-r1/work/Digest-HMAC-1.01/blib/lib /var/tmp/portage/Digest-HMAC-1.01-r1/work/Digest-HMAC-1.01/blib/arch /etc/perl /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.2 /usr/local/lib/site_perl /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 . /etc/perl /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.8.2 /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.2/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/5.8.2 /usr/local/lib/site_perl /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.8.0 .) at /var/tmp/portage/Digest-HMAC-1.01-r1/work/Digest-HMAC-1.01/blib/lib/Digest/HMAC.pm line 35
t/rfc2202....dubious
Test returned status 255 (wstat 65280, 0xff00)
DIED. FAILED tests 8-14
Failed 7/14 tests, 50.00% okay
Failed Test Stat Wstat Total Fail Failed List of Failed
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
t/rfc2202.t 255 65280 14 14 100.00% 8-14
Failed 1/1 test scripts, 0.00% okay. 7/14 subtests failed, 50.00% okay.
make: *** [test_dynamic] Error 2
!!! ERROR: dev-perl/Digest-HMAC-1.01-r1 failed.
!!! Function src_compile, Line 22, Exitcode 2
!!! Tests didn't work out. Aborting!
|
Don't know what to do. It's a dep for Mail-SpamAssassin and I'd like to get it to work. All the other perl modules for SpamAssassin emerged successfully.
Thanks in advance. |

Posted: Sat Jan 10, 2004 7:56 am Post subject: Post subject: emerge Digest-HMAC fails. Log inside. |
|
|
| try emerge Digest-base |
|
| Back to top |
|
 |
cputoaster n00b

Joined: 05 Apr 2003 Posts: 1
|
Posted: Sun Jan 11, 2004 12:21 pm Post subject: Digest-base |
|
|
| works, thx. looks like a dep bug? |
